How do I program a keyless entry system
With a key fob you can lock and unlock your vehicle without the traditional car keys. It transmits radio signals to the vehicle, which then activates the ignition and locking systems that are built into the car. The signal allows the car's identification to be read, meaning it can determine that you are near enough to operate the trunk and doors.
These systems can be programmed at home, however the procedure may differ between manufacturers and vehicles. Some manufacturers employ a simple RF (radio-frequency) programming method, whereas others require specialized equipment to access the system's internal memory. It is crucial to study the instructions and follow them closely. Missing a step or performing the procedure incorrectly could result in the new device not being properly programmed.

How do I program a key fob
To program a keyfob, first, you need to ensure that you have the correct key. Key fobs with blanks are available through the internet or from many automotive dealerships. They must be designed specifically for the brand and model of the vehicle to which they will be attached. This information is available on the key fobs or by searching for the vehicle's VIN.
Once you have the right key, follow the following steps to start programming mode: Step inside your vehicle on the driver's side and shut all of its doors except for the driver's door. Insert and remove the key from the ignition multiple times until the hazard lights flash twice. This indicates that you are in the programming mode and your vehicle is ready to accept the new fob. Repeat the process for each of the new fobs you wish to program.
How to Program a Keyless Entry Remote?
They're useful and convenient, but can be a headache in the event that they don't function properly. If you notice that yours is malfunctioning the first thing you should try is replacing the battery. This usually resolves the problem, but if that doesn't work then you should think about taking your car to professional.

It is possible to program key fobs by yourself dependent on the model and make of the vehicle. It is not necessary to bring them to dealers. However, it is important to know that not all cars allow self-programming and you will need to consult your owner's manual or look up your vehicle online for detailed instructions.
The first step is to gather all the fobs you want to program and keep them close by. It is important to ensure that you have all the fobs you wish to program close by before you begin. Then, you'll need to get inside your vehicle and shut all the doors. Press and hold the button to lock on one of your new key fobs for a couple of seconds. You will then need to wait for your vehicle to respond to your request, usually by cycling the locks or emitting a chime. If you can hear the locks cycling or a sound, you can begin programming your additional fobs.
Repeat the process for each fob you need to program, making sure that you complete the process within the timeframe of the vehicle. Check the fobs after you've finished to make sure they function properly. If the fobs do not work properly, you may require a repeat of the process or consult a professional.
